INSPECTION
Check steering head bearings:
At the 1000 mile (1600 km) service interval.
At every 2500 mile (4000 km) service interval thereafter.
When storing or removing the motorcycle for the season.
Lubricate and adjust at every 20,000 mile (32,000 km)
service interval.
1.
Detach clutch cable at handlebar.
2.
Remove seat and fuel tank. See
COVER/FUEL TANK.
3.
Attach lifting straps to frame tube behind steering neck.
Raise front wheel off floor using a floor hoist and lifting
straps.
4.
Turn front wheel to full right lock.
5.
See
Figure 2-91.
Attach a spring scale into the hole in
the front axle. With scale 90 degrees from fork leg, pull
front wheel to center position. It should take 6.5-7 lbs
(2.9-3.2 kg) to pull front wheel to center.
6.
Attach clutch cable to handlebar.

NOTE
Check that clutch and throttle cables do not bind when mea-
suring bearing resistance.
Lubrication
At 10,000 miles (16,100 km) and every 10,000 miles
(16,100 km) thereafter, lubricate the steering head bearings

To adjust:
a.
Loosen both pinch screws (7) on lower triple clamp.
b.
Loosen center cap pinch screw (9) on upper triple
clamp.
c.
Loosen cap nut (1), then tighten to 48-52 ft-lbs (65-
71 Nm) to seat bearing. Loosen cap nut, apply LOC-
TITE THREADLOCKER 243 (Blue) to threads of
fork stem and retighten cap nut to 28-32 ft-lbs (38-
43 Nm).
7.
Recheck tension using spring scale. See Step 5.
8.
Tighten both lower triple clamp pinch screws (7) to 22-29
ft-lbs (30-39 Nm).
9.
Tighten center cap pinch screw to 7-10 ft-lbs (10-14
Nm).
